How The Pretend Taste Test Works
Families set up a tasting with one toy pizza and one real slice. Kids use sight, touch, smell, and taste to compare. Studies indicate roleplay helps children describe flavors and textures clearly.

FAQ
Q: Is this activity safe for young children?
A: Supervise closely. Keep real pizza toppings plain and cut toy pieces to prevent choking.
Q: Can this game expand learning beyond taste?
A: Yes. Children can count slices, match shapes, and practice simple menu play.
